Builder wrote contract to where buyer was liable to pay for lot tax at closing but, issued a credit at closing for most of this cost IF the buyer used Lennar Mortgage. External Mortgage company could not make this $ amount up in credits in order to be competitive on closing costs.

Mixed review
- Anonymous
- Verified HomeBuyer
- March 14, 2023
- Pendleton, SC
The people who work for Lennar were great. All were very helpful and very responsive. I’m not sure the corporation was as great. Not long after we signed our contract the price for identical unsold homes was reduced. We came to an agreement and they supplemented our purchase with other perks. However, shortly after that the price was reduced again. In the end we paid $13,000 more for our home at closing than the price the same homes were being sold for on that date. Hard not to feel like we were taken.

Ask the right questions
- Elaine L.
- Verified HomeBuyer
- June 14, 2023
- Travelers Rest, SC
The positive was the on-site construction manager (Will) who was communicative and responsive. The Lennar mortgage process (Robert) was straightforward and managed the process well. Be aware that the advertised “Everything’s Included” is not accurate. Not included: basic blinds, refrigerator, washer/dryer, unfinished garage, mirror in powder room, and no irrigation system or plan for the lawn. Our community also has an unfinished wall that is grotesque and an eyesore evident to the entire town. Internet cables located in the walls are a bust and shoddily placed.
